What Makes Venetian Blinds Unique?
Adjustable Slats for Precision Light Control
The magic of Venetian blinds lies in their adjustable slats. Want soft, diffused light? Tilt them halfway. Need complete darkness? Close them fully. Unlike curtains that only offer an “all or nothing” approach, Venetian blinds let you customize light levels with millimeter precision.
Material Choices: Wood, Aluminum, and Faux Wood
Not all Venetian blinds are the same. Depending on your needs, you can choose:
-
Wooden Venetian blinds – Warm, natural aesthetic (great for living rooms).
-
Aluminum Venetian blinds – Sleek, modern, and ultra-durable (ideal for kitchens).
-
Faux wood Venetian blinds – Affordable, moisture-resistant (perfect for bathrooms).
Each material affects light diffusion differently—wood offers a softer glow, while aluminum provides sharper light control.
Venetian Blinds vs. Other Window Coverings
Venetian Blinds vs. Roller Blinds
Roller blinds are simple, but they lack flexibility. You either roll them up (full light) or down (total darkness). Venetian blinds, on the other hand, let you adjust light without sacrificing visibility.
Venetian Blinds vs. Curtains
Curtains add softness but can’t compete with Venetian blinds for light precision. Plus, blinds take up less space and are easier to clean—no dust-trapping fabric!

Choosing the Right Venetian Blinds
Measuring Your Windows Correctly
A poorly measured blind = gaps and light leaks. Always measure:
✔ Width (inside or outside the window frame)
✔ Height (top to sill)
Color & Finish Selection
-
White/cream blinds – Reflect light, making rooms brighter.
-
Dark blinds – Reduce glare and add contrast.

FAQs
1. Do Venetian blinds block out all light?
They can if fully closed, but for total blackout, consider adding blackout liners.
2. Are Venetian blinds child-safe?
Yes! Opt for cordless designs to prevent hazards.
3. Can Venetian blinds help with energy efficiency?
Absolutely! Closed blinds in summer reduce heat, and in winter, they insulate windows.
4. How long do Venetian blinds last?
With proper care, 5-10 years (aluminum lasts longest).
